Panaji: Goa on Saturday reported 37 fresh Covid-19 infections, two deaths and 21 recoveries, taking the number of active cases close to 400.
With 2,322 tests, the daily case positivity rate remained below 2%, up from around 2% in the last three days, while the recovery rate remained at 97.8%.
During the day, one patient was admitted to the hospital and two were discharged.
Margao’s active caseload rose to 63, while that of Navelim was 28. The number of Panaji Urban Health Centers rose to 44, while other centers in North Goa that were seeing a marginal increase in infections were Chimbel and Candolim, though their numbers were down to 30.
